Download NowNEW DELHI: The Gujarat Secondary and Higher Secondary Education Board (GSHSEB) announced the GSEB Class 10 result date 2023 today. The board will declare the GSEB SSC results 2023 on May 25 at 8 AM for Class 10th students. Those who appeared in the Gujarat Board SSC Class 10th exams 2023 will be able to check results through the official website, gseb.org.
GSEB board students who appeared in the HSC science stream were able to download the marksheets on May 2. The overall pass percentage of GSEB HSC results 2023 was 65.58%.
The board held the Gujarat SSC examinations 2023 from March 14 to March 28, 2023. Those students who score a minimum of 33% in each subject will be declared pass in the GSEB 10th results 2023.
How to check GSEB 10th result 2023
Students will be able to download the provisional mark sheet certificate by following the steps given below.
- Visit the Gujarat board result official website, www.gseb.org 2023 STD 10
- On the homepage, click on the GSEB Board SSC result 2023 download link.
- Enter the school index number and password or the seat number as asked.
- Click on the “Submit” button.
- GSEB SSC Result 2023 will be displayed on the screen.
Students will also be able to check their scores through the SMS app on mobile. They will have to type an SMS in the format: SSC<space>SeatNumber and send it to 56263. The marks secured in each subject will be notified on the mobile number.
